South Pacific Show Continues To Shake Up Kauai

May 04, 2005

The South Pacific dinner theater, which has been playing to sold-out crowds at the Radisson Kauai Beach Resort, has extended its run at the property through January 2006. The Broadway musical that inspired the hit movie filmed on Kauai, opened at the resort in January 2004.

The colorful show includes such classic songs as “I’m Gonna Wash That Man Right Outa My Hair,” “Bali Hai,” “I’m in Love With a Wonderful Guy” and “There is Nothin’ Like a Dame.” The theater production is produced by the Hawaii Association of Performing Arts (HAPA). It is directed by Gabriel Oberman and Brenda Turville, with musical direction by Alan Van Zee. The show includes all local talent, with over 20 cast members.

According to producer Alain Dussaud, “South Pacific has become symbolic to Kauai and needed to return to the island. There really are not a whole lot of family entertainment choices at night. This combination of dinner and theatre, and Radisson’s central location, has attracted tourists and kamaaina from all over the island.”

The three-hour dinner show takes place every Monday and Wednesday night at 6 p.m. in the resort’s Jasmine Ballroom. Priced at $68 for adults and $50 for children 12 and under, the evening includes a dinner buffet, one cocktail per adult and access to a no-host bar. The show is commissionable to travel agents.

“Like theater elsewhere as in New York, this is cultural entertainment,” said Tom Bartlett, director of sales. “People of all ages seem to enjoy it. I hadn't seen it since Kailua High School 40 years ago when it was done as a senior play. I enjoyed it then and enjoy it now. It’s a very good show!”

Special Radisson Rates

Special packages at the Radisson Kauai Beach Resort include “Kauai On Wheels,” covering deluxe accommodations, compact rental car use and daily buffet breakfast for two in the Naupaka Terrace from $229 per night.

The hotel’s “Bed and Breakfast in Paradise” includes deluxe accommodations and daily Naupaka Terrace buffet breakfast for two. Through June 30, nightly rates are from $199. For July 1, rates are $10 additional per category.

Valid through December 20, Radisson rates are based on double occupancy. All packages include complimentary Manager’s Cocktail Party nightly from 5-6 p.m., nightly torchlighting ceremony with Polynesian dance show, complimentary airport shuttle service and complimentary tennis on the hotel’s four courts.

Centrally located on Kauai’s eastern shore, the 25-acre Radisson Kauai Beach Resort features 340 rooms, seven suites, complete meeting and banquet facilities, three restaurants, a boutique spa and fitness center, tennis courts and a “super pool” complex.
